description  FUNCTION: Automated description from the Alliance of Genome Resources (Release 7.1.0)

Enables poly(A)-specific ribonuclease activity. Involved in positive regulation of nuclear-transcribed mRNA catabolic process, deadenylation-dependent decay; positive regulation of nuclear-transcribed mRNA poly(A) tail shortening; and regulatory ncRNA-mediated gene silencing. Acts upstream of or within P-body assembly and positive regulation of RNA metabolic process. Located in P-body and nucleus. Part of CCR4-NOT complex. Is expressed in several structures, including alimentary system; central nervous system; early embryo; genitourinary system; and skeleton. Orthologous to human CNOT7 (CCR4-NOT transcription complex subunit 7).
PHENOTYPE: Homozygous null mice display male sterility with oligo-teratozoospermia, impaired sperm motility, unsynchronized spermatid maturation, and Sertoli cell abnormalities. [provided by MGI curators]
